Our verdict is Likely benign. Variant got -1 ACMG points: 0P and 1B. BP4
The NM_001267550.2(TTN):c.61073C>T(p.Pro20358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000558 in 1,613,048 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★).

not provided Uncertain:1
Not observed at significant frequency in large population cohorts (gnomAD); Missense variant in a gene in which most reported pathogenic variants are truncating/loss of function; Has not been previously published as pathogenic or benign to our knowledge -
